I cycled alone across Saudi Arabia.

For three months, I would pedal thousands of kilometres across the Arabian desert, travelling through one of the most misunderstood and rapidly changing countries on Earth.

From the desert megaprojects of NEOM and the transformation plans of Vision 2030, to remote Bedouin villages, ancient oasis valleys, camel herders, and extraordinary hospitality deep in the desert, this was a once in a lifetime opportunity to immerse myself in Saudi culture.

In this episode, I cycle from the Red Sea coast into the Hejaz mountains, exploring modern Saudi Arabia while trying to understand a country often defined abroad by its authoritarian government, religious conservatism, oil wealth, and human rights controversies.

Along the way, I stay in mosques and desert farms, learn about Bedouin culture, explore the oasis valley of Al Disah, and witness the enormous transformation projects reshaping the kingdom under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man.

On my cycling journey across Saudi Arabia, I’d attempt to understand one of the most fascinating and misunderstood countries in the Middle East, the good and the bad.
